A
Faculty Development Program on .NET Technology was
organized in the institute in collaboration with
Microsoft, India from 18th December to 22nd December 2006.
Faculty members from more than 15 different colleges of
Rajasthan have participated in this training program.
The workshop was inaugurated by Dr. B. K. Sharma, Dean,
Faculty of Science, University of Rajasthan. Mr. Chandar
Sundaram, Head, Academic Alliance Microsoft, Banglore was
also present in the inaugural session. Mr. Chandar
Sundaram, said that we want more such types of programs to
be organized so as to promote Microsoft Technologies in
Rajasthan in India.
On the last day Valedictory session was organized. Mr.
Nitin Mittal, the Director of Microsoft Pricing and
licensing was present to mark the end of five day faculty
development program.
He along with many faculty members and students of Global
Institute of Technology had an open discussion in which
everyone had the opportunity to ask him about Microsoft,
Microsoft products, the future of Microsoft and many other
questions for Microsoft India and the US.
The session ended with the distribution of the
certificates and Microsoft software by Mr. Nitin Mittal.
Special software editions were given to many outside
faculty member by Mr. Rakesh Singhal and at last the vote
of thanks was delivered by Dr. SP Gupta, Principal, GIT.
The program was organized and coordinated by Mr. Prakash
Ramani, (HOD, Department of Computers & IT) and his team. |
